BUFFALO GROVE, Ill. – State Rep. Jonathan Carroll, D-Buffalo Grove, is encouraging residents to shop local this weekend in an effort to support small businesses during the holiday season rush that often benefits big-box stores and online retailers over small businesses.

“Small Business Saturday is a way to support small businesses that during the holiday season have to compete against the big box stores and online retailers,” Carroll said. “Small businesses in our neighborhood employ friends and neighbors, donate money to local charities, sponsor little league teams and volunteer in the community.”

Saturday, Nov. 26 marks the 7th annual Small Business Saturday, which was created to boost small business sales during one of the busiest shopping weekends of the year. Shopping locally helps provide jobs for area residents, tax revenue, sponsorships for community groups, support for charities and excellent personalized services.

“Our local community succeeds when small businesses succeed,” Carroll continued. “I encourage folks to shop at small businesses not only on Small Business Saturday, but year-round.”
